    There still ain't no such thing as the "best phone" (ever), after all it comes down to each persons requirements. You want a big screen to enjoy your games and videos? The Q10 surely ain'kt the ideal device for that stuff. You're on a tight budget and looking for a rather inexpensive device? The Q10 isn't actually the phone to shop for. You want all the apps and look for maximum custimzation options? Again, the Q10 wouldn't be the obvious choice in that case.

    I own a Q10 myself since it got released here back in May and I've waited impatiently for the release. In some cases it exceeded my expectations, in some points it simply disappointed. It is a great phone for sure, it is mostly a pleasure to use and hold, simply working with it is good. I've yet to get "bored" with it, even though it doesn't come with many options to customize it. But it still is some kind of a niche device: Today too many people want bigger screens, with at least a size of 4" or even more. So the Q10 looks not really up to date with the 3.1" display. Hardware keyboards are also becoming, or rather have become some sort of an oddity - a niche feature. With an all-touch device you simply have more flexibility and not too many people care any more about the experience a hardware keyboard delivers.


    What I absolutely can't agree with is your statement regarding Q10 hardware running OS7. Why would you want that? OS7 is pushed beyond its limits, it had its time. Yes there are certain things BB10 lacks with, mostly special things which were a common feature on legacy OS. But, at least for me, that doesn't justify the step back to that old Java OS. Keep developing BB10 and bringing it forwards is waaaay better than keep investing on that dead end road.

    Even before I had a BlackBerry, my first one was the Bold 9900, the first reactions to OS7 devices were bad. BB10 should've been out back at the time then.

    Personally I don't have a clue why the Q10 isn't selling well. The actual reviews were pretty good, most negative stuff mentioned should've been irrelevant to interested people anyways. Maybe it is the lack of marketing, the caution of people how good the new plattform will actually develop. Quite some people here on the other hand tried the Q and decided to switch back to the old devices, because they didn't like or didn't want to get used to the new OS.
    I still would like to see some more figures which compares all the sales of the specific BB10 devices against each other.
